    Lvl69 HQ macro(all NQ mats/no RNG skills) - Possible if you had lvl60 4* requirements

    EDIT: The lvl 70 rotation I recently posted is the exact same rotation as this rotation though does require higher stats:
    http://forum.square-enix.com/ffxiv/t...20#post4231020

    If you have the lvl 70 stat requirements(1137/955/391) then you can use the macro for both lvl 70/69 80 durability crafts.

    Lvl 69 crafts - Difficulty = 2854/ Quality = 12913/ Durability = 80
    No skill RNG rotation
    Example where this might be useful: Zelkova Ring.

    Craftsmanship Required = 1060
    Control required = 938
    CP required = 391
    Specialist required: Yes
    Food required: No/Maybe

    /ac "Initial Preparations" <wait.3>
    /ac "Comfort Zone" <wait.2>
    /ac "Inner Quiet" <wait.2>
    /ac "Specialty: Reflect" <wait.3>
    /ac "Steady Hand II" <wait.2>
    /ac "Piece by Piece" <wait.3>
    /ac "Piece by Piece" <wait.3>
    /ac "Prudent Touch" <wait.3>
    /ac "Prudent Touch" <wait.3>
    /ac "Prudent Touch" <wait.3>
    /ac "Steady Hand II" <wait.2>
    /ac "Prudent Touch" <wait.3>
    /ac "Comfort Zone" <wait.2>
    /ac "Prudent Touch" <wait.3>
    /echo Macro #1 complete <se.1>

    /ac "Prudent Touch" <wait.3>
    /ac "Prudent Touch" <wait.3>
    /ac "Great Strides" <wait.2>
    /ac "Innovation" <wait.2>
    /ac "Ingenuity II" <wait.2>
    /ac "Byregot's Brow" <wait.3>
    /ac "Observe" <wait.2>
    /ac "Focused Synthesis" <wait.3>
    /ac "Observe" <wait.2>
    /ac "Focused Synthesis" <wait.3>
    /echo Macro #2 complete <se.1>

    Cross class skills needed

    Comfort Zone(Alchemist lvl50) - Only needed if you need comfort zone to meet CP requirements
    Steady Hand II(Culinarian lvl37)
    Piece by Piece(Armorer lvl50)
    Innovation(Goldsmith lvl50)
    Ingenuity II(Blacksmith lvl50)

    Notes

    - This is by no means the easiest/fastest rotation, just a rotation I quickly came up with when trying to make a macro using my old lvl 60 Ironworks gear.
    - Condition procs e.g. bad timing on excellent/poor proc could result in not hitting 100%
    - 405/419 CP required if not using 1/2 comfort zones respectively
    - The CP requirements don’t take into account the chance for CP reduction.
    - lvl 60 4* stat requirements were 995 craftsmanship/955 control so craftsmanship requirement is quite high however something cheap like emerald soup should suffice if needed.
    - This macro is assuming you're level 70

    About this rotation:

    - Can NQ the craft if a touch is activated on a poor condition
    - If Initial preparations proc then the CP requirement would be even lower
    - I haven't taken the "Stroke of Genius" trait into consideration either so 376cp would suffice if you have it
    - Control requirement is the exact amount needed to 100% it based on getting no good/excellent/poor procs so even 1 less control point & it will won't 100%
    - Craftsmanship requirement is the exact amount needed to complete the craft, 1 less craftsmanship & the craft won't finish

    The rotation can be altered to better suit anyone who uses it:
    - If you have plenty of CP, replacing the second "Comfort Zone" with "Innovation" would increase your chances of getting a HQ craft if a touch activates on a poor condition
    - Completely removing comfort zone would speed up the rotation, no point having it if you have plenty of cp
